Mumbai, which earlier went by Bombay, is the most inhabited city and the biggest metropolis in India. The city is located in the Maharashtra State. Mumbai is the economic capital of India. It is the hub of entertainment, textile, clothing, automotive, biscuits and many other industries. Apart from the dazzling modernity, the city has a range of historic sites like The Asiatic Society, Kanheri Caves, Vasai, August Kranti Maidan, Gateway of India, Elephant caves and so forth to provide a treat to the eyes. Chhatrapati Shivaji International Airport, which is the primary airport in Mumbai, is sited 23 miles north of the city center. Among the most populous metropolis areas in the US, Dallas comes at number four. Dallas is a prime tour and trading destination in the US state of Texas. Dallas is the third most populated city in Texas. Dallas was founded in 1841. The city is a big contributor to the state’s economy and it’s one of the fastest growing US cities with a progressive culture. The Dallas city and the Fort Worth metropolis are served by the Dallas/Fort Worth International Airport primarily. The airport is the hub of American Airlines managing more than 900 flights every day. The airport is sited 17.5 miles downtown Fort Worth. The Dallas/Fort Worth International Airport serves the Dallas-Fort Worth area in the US state of Texas. It is owned by the City of Dallas and the City of Fort Worth and it is operated by DFW Airport Board. It is a hub for American Airlines, UPS Airlines and America flight. Mumbai city creates the most number of jobs in the country and its entertainment industry generates huge revenues every year. Earlier, there used to exist seven islands - Bombay Island, Parel, Colaba, Mazagaon, Mahim, Worli, and Old Woman's Island. These islands collectively formed the Mumbai city later; it was called Bombay back then. Chhatrapati Shivaji International Airport is the primary airport sited 23 miles north of the city center.
